Continued Professional Services Sample Clauses

Continued Professional Services. Following any notice of termination hereunder, whether given by COMPANY or DOCTOR, DOCTOR and COMPANY will fully cooperate with each other in all matters relating to the performance or discontinuance of Professional Services, as appropriate, at the Locations by DOCTOR and the orderly transition of patients.

  • Transitional Services Seller shall provide to Buyer, with respect to each Specified Business, upon written request from Buyer received by Seller no later than 30 days prior to the Closing Date, such services as may be reasonably requested by Buyer in connection with the operation of such Specified Business for a commercially reasonable transition period following the Closing to allow for conversion of existing or replacement services, in each case to the extent and only to the extent Seller or its Affiliates retains the Assets and employees necessary to allow the provision of such services (“Transitional Services”). In addition, between the date hereof and the Closing, Seller shall use commercially reasonable efforts to cooperate with Buyer to assist Buyer in developing and implementing a plan of transition. Buyer shall promptly reimburse Seller for the reasonable out-of-pocket costs and any incremental costs and expenses necessary to provide Transitional Services. All other terms and conditions for the provision of Transitional Services shall be reasonably satisfactory to both Buyer and Seller and subject to applicable Law.

  • Transition Services The Purchasers will provide to the Sellers termination assistance as reasonably requested in order to provide an orderly transition following the termination of the Agreement (or any portion thereof), and the Sellers will provide to the Purchasers reasonable cooperation and assistance in connection therewith. In connection with this transition assistance, the Purchasers and Sellers will reasonably cooperate in the transition of the Services from the Purchasers to any Replacement Provider. With respect to the Serviced Appointments subject to termination, the Sellers shall provide the Purchasers with notice of the effective date (each, a “Transition Effective Date”) of the transition of the Services to a Replacement Provider. Notwithstanding any termination of the Agreement (or any portion thereof) in accordance with this Article II, with respect to the Serviced Appointments subject to termination, the rights and obligations of the parties under the Servicing Agreement shall remain in effect until the applicable Transition Effective Date.
